The Department of Veteran Affairs is looking for a vendor to provide Dental Service with specialized in person training to support validated digital denture and fixed prosthodontic workflows.

Multiple sites have requested comprehensive instruction in Oversize and Ivotion Dentures using both 3Shape and CAM workflows, which requires approximately 2.5 to 3 days of training.

Additional requested modules include Crown and Bridge, Screw Retained Crown and Bridge, and Custom Abutments.

These validated workflows are necessary to maintain staff competency and meet ongoing clinical demand.

Workflows related to implant-supported dentures and dentures over titanium bars have been excluded, as they are not currently validated.

The training will be performed at the Malcolm Randall VA Medical Center in Gainesville, FL.

How to bid on this

This is a contract solicitation, not a grant. To bid, you submit a proposal (usually a price and a description of how you would do the work) directly to the government, through the channel the official listing specifies, not through Oppward.

  1. Make sure your business has an active SAM.gov registration. You cannot be paid on a federal contract without one.
  2. Read the full solicitation on the official listing above, especially the scope of work, not just this summary. Our guide to reading a solicitation walks through what to look for.
  3. Check the set-aside listed above and confirm your business actually qualifies for it before you spend time on a proposal. See our guide to set-asides if the category is unfamiliar.
  4. Submit your proposal by the deadline, using the exact submission method the official listing states. A technically on-time bid sent the wrong way is often treated as late.
